00:19The MAZI is back in action on the Casablanca stock market.
00:22The MAZI bounced from 1.20% to 16,490 points.
00:27The activity on the central market has intensified today with a global volume of 497 million dirhams.
00:33And it is the BCP title that dominated the exchanges.
00:36With a flow of 132 million dirhams, BCP has progressed by more than 2.43%.
00:42Then comes Atijari Wafaa Bank which captures nearly 60 million dirhams, showing a progression of more than 1.90%.
00:50Marsa Maroc also attracted about 60 million dirhams and gained more than 2.58%.
00:56On the Palmares side, it is the Feynier Brocette title which imposed itself as the value of the day with a bounce of more than 10%, closing at 252 dirhams.
01:07The Tunindex ends in a sharp rise on the Tunisian stock market.
01:10The index has progressed from 0.14% to 10,820 points.
01:15The Tunisian insurance and insurance company has imposed itself on the market with a volume of 1,273,000 dinars and a progression of more than 4.49%.
01:26On the other hand, the Tunisian bank Atijari knows a setback after its performance the day before.
01:31Atijari Bank loses 0.24% and draws 963,000 dinars.
01:36SAH continues to benefit from the trust of investors.
01:40The stock progresses by more than 2.15% with a volume of 762,000 dinars.
01:45On the Palmares side, Smart stands out with a rise of more than 4.54%.
01:51And after a break, the regional stock exchange continues its wave of profit.
01:57The BRVM Composite has again given up 0.32% and is now at 290.91 points.
02:04Transactions have brought in 1,710,000,000 francs CFA.
02:08The Société Générale Côte d'Ivoire has also caught 686,000,000 francs CFA, recording an increase of 1.60%.
02:18On the replay table, we find the title Sonatel, which abandons 1.77% and captures 242,000,000 francs CFA.
02:26The stock closes at 25,000 francs CFA.
02:29The Ivorian bank company loses 0.23% in a volume of 102,000,000 francs CFA.
02:34Total Energy Côte d'Ivoire continues to attract interest and above all profit.
02:40The stock falls by minus 1.53% and drains 74,000,000 francs CFA.
02:45But it is the value of the publisher Ney Seda who accuses the strongest replay of the session.
02:50The stock has given up minus 5.56%.
